- Class Description:
- This seminar will examine linguistic ideas from various times and places, not with the goal of achieving a complete survey, but rather from the perspective of generative linguistics with the goal of "an art lover" who looks at history "to find in it things that are of particular value and that obtain part of their value" (Chomsky, 1971). In other words, the goal will be to identify past ideas that bear on modern thinking, and try to understand them in ways that illuminate modern thinking. We will start by situating generative grammar amid recent conflicts between behaviorist/empiricist and mentalist/rationalist ideas, then delve into such past linguistics idea as those of Panini and his successors, the Port-Royal grammarians, Saussure and the structuralists, and so on.
